In this role, you will mainly support M&A in strategy definition, deal analysis and transaction execution. You will play a key role in analysing, modelling, due diligence coordination, and project management, ensuring timely reporting and alignment with executive stakeholders. The position offers broad exposure to high-impact initiatives and different stakeholders in Advario, requiring strong analytical, communication, and organizational skills.
Responsibilities- Support end-to-end M&A transaction processes, including target screening, financial valuation, due diligence, deal execution, and integration planning.
- Build and maintain financial models for target evaluation, including DCF, comparable company analysis, and merger consequences modeling.
- Support due diligence processes by coordinating data requests, analysing financial information, and preparing summary findings.
- Conduct comprehensive market research, competitor analysis, and industry benchmarking to support strategic decision-making.
- Collaborate with cross-functional and global teams (Legal, Finance, HR, Operations, IT, etc.) to gather and analyse data relevant to ongoing and prospective transactions.
- Prepare executive-level presentations, reports, and investment memos for internal and external stakeholders.
- Monitor and track deal pipeline activities, providing regular updates to the Strategy and M&A leadership team.
- Assist in post-merger integration efforts by coordinating with internal teams and tracking progress against integration milestones.
- Contribute to continuous improvement of M&A and PMO processes, templates, and best practices.
- Ensure high-quality work output, attention to detail, and effective stakeholder communication.
- Perform other duties as required to support the Strategy and M&A function.
